  • Description: An evergreen shrub or tree with narrow, aromatic, bright-green, ovate leaves whose flowers apper in spring and are followed by black berries. Its leaves are habitually used in cooking.
  • Origin: Mediterranean Europe
  • Classification: LAURUS, Genus, LAURACEAE, Family
  • Climatic resistance: Medium, -5°C / -10°C USDA 8
  • Environmental resistance: Resistance to salt spray atmospheres, Resistant to dry soils, Resistant to calcareous soils
  • Max height: 08,00, –, 12,00, meters
  • Use: Hedges, Small gardens, Parks
